AN ACT to amend the penal law, in relation to establishing the offenses of reckless endangerment of an emergency service person in the first degree and reckless endangerment of an emergency service person in the second degree

AI Summary

This bill establishes the offenses of "reckless endangerment of an emergency service person in the first degree" and "reckless endangerment of an emergency service person in the second degree." The first degree offense applies when a person's reckless conduct during a fire or emergency evacuation results in the death of an emergency service person, or the person has a previous conviction for the first or second degree offense within the last 10 years. The second degree offense applies when a person, without the proper building permit, alters a building in a way that impedes emergency egress, and their conduct results in the injury of an emergency service person. Both offenses are felonies, with the first degree offense being a class D felony and the second degree offense being a class E felony.
